hi joondalup sounds great,is it much dearer for a holiday furnished rental,cheers

 

Holiday rentals in Joondalup are well priced, the further South from Joondalup along the coast you go they get dearer, the further North you go they get cheaper, of you cross over Marmion Drive freeway side into suburbs like Heathridge Cragie etc, they get cheaper too, but you are here for the beach lifestyle so try staying beachside of Marmion, Ocean Reef, Mulaloo, Hillaries, Iluka, Burns Beach etc, if you head up north to Mindarie or Old Quinns, which is literally a 5 minute drive North, prices go down unless you end uo in Mindarie Marina, theat gets quite pricey, look on Stayz.com
